WV Council of International Programs

The WV Council of International Programs (WVCIP) has been serving WVU and the Morgantown Community for over 50 years. The Council provides professional development experiences for international professionals to serve, and opportunities to facilitate cross-cultural and professional exchange by:

  • Recruiting international participants to come to West Virginia to engage in a professional and cultural experience. 
  • Providing training and work-related experiences utilizing the resources of WVU and the broader community.
  • Creating unique opportunities for participants to learn about life in the USA.
  • Providing West Virginians an opportunity to broaden their knowledge and understanding of other countries.
